Votes at a glance: McAlester council approves budget, water grants, street overlays and several contracts
Summary
The McAlester City Council adopted the fiscal-year budget ordinance, approved budget amendments and emergencies, accepted an EPA DWSRF grant, and authorized multiple infrastructure contracts and agreements.
The McAlester City Council on Oct. 16 took a series of votes covering the fiscal-year budget, water-system grants and several infrastructure and services contracts. Below is a concise list of each formal action, the motion text (when on the record), mover/second if stated, and the roll-call outcome as recorded in the meeting transcript.
Votes at a glance 1) Ordinance No. 2845 — FY 2025–26 budget Motion text: Approval of ordinance No. 2845 establishing the fiscal-year 2025–26 budget. Mover/Second: Motion moved; second recorded as Councilor Boatwright (mover name not clearly recorded in the transcript). Roll call: Councilors Boatwright, Roden, Gilmore, Woodley, Stone and Mayor Justin Few — all recorded “Yes.” Outcome: Approved (roll call unanimous among those present).
2) Emergency clause for the budget ordinance Motion text: Approve the emergency clause for the budget ordinance. Mover/Second: Motion by Councilor Gilmore; second by Councilor Stone. Roll call: All recorded “Yes.” Outcome: Approved.
